* Blowguns are an option in ''DungeonCrawl''. They don't do much damage, but are excellent for inflicting status conditions (most commonly poison, but some other StandardStatusEffects are also available) from a distance without relying on magic. Curare needles are particularly effective, as they also inflict damage through asphyxiation.

* In ''[[HumanxCommonwealth Midworld]]'' and its sequel, human hunters on the green world use rifle-like blow guns called "snufflers", modeled on [[LostTechnology distant memories]] of their colonial ancestors' firearms. They're powered by tank seeds, which contain air bladders that burst when punctured, propelling their toxic-thorn projectiles with great force.
